A Bitcoin Exchange-Traded Fund (ETF) allows you to gain exposure to Bitcoin without the need to purchase it directly. ETFs track the price of Bitcoin and enable trading on traditional stock exchanges, making it more accessible for both institutional and retail investors alike.
The outflow of $869.86 million raises some serious questions about investor confidence. Historical comparisons suggest that significant outflows like this have often preceded bearish trends in altcoins. This is definitely something to keep in mind if you’re trading meme coins.
Bitcoin's price movements are known to directly influence altcoin trends. When Bitcoin sees a significant price drop, meme coins often follow suit, mirroring trader sentiment and market volatility. So, staying tuned to Bitcoin's performance can be crucial for your trading strategy.
--- ## 2. Exploring the Meme Coin Landscape: Solana vs. BSC ### 2.1 What Are Meme Coins?- Definition: Meme coins are cryptocurrencies often inspired by internet memes or cultural phenomena, designed for fun rather than serious investment.
- Characteristics: They tend to have high volatility, community-driven growth, and can experience rapid price spikes.
- Popular Meme Coins: Recently, coins like BONK, WIF, and PEPE have gained considerable traction.
